How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Rolling Hills Estates?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Rolling Hills Estates Studio Apartments | $2,316 | $1,650 | $4,006 |
Rolling Hills Estates 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,976 | $1,800 | $5,900 |
Rolling Hills Estates 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,459 | $2,295 | $7,709 |
Rolling Hills Estates 3 Bedroom Apartments | $5,292 | $3,200 | $7,800 |
Rolling Hills Estates 4 Bedroom Apartments | $5,600 | $5,210 | $5,910 |
